Caring for Begonia Wings Maculata Polka Dot

Begonia Wings Maculata Polka Dot is one of the most popular indoor begonias. Its large wing-shaped leaves adorned with white spots ("polka dots") and a red-pink underside are unique. It grows upright and, with proper care, blooms with small pink flowers.

Watering Water moderately – only when the top layer of the substrate (approx. 2–3 cm) is dry. It dislikes overwatering or complete drying out. Caution: Do not allow water to stand in the saucer under the pot. Water directly into the substrate – not on the leaves, to prevent spots.

Light Prefers bright, indirect light – an east or west-facing window is ideal.

  • Avoid direct sun, which can scorch leaves and make spots turn white.

  • Lack of light can make the spots less pronounced and reduce flowering.

🌡️ Temperature and Air

  • Ideal temperature: 18–26 °C.

  • Cold: Does not tolerate temperatures below 15 °C or drafts.

  • Humidity: Prefers higher air humidity (50–70%). A humidifier or a tray with moist pebbles is recommended. Do not mist directly on the leaves.

Fertilization During the growing season (spring–summer), fertilize every 3–4 weeks with diluted liquid fertilizer at a quarter to half strength. Omit fertilization entirely in winter. Begonias are sensitive to over-fertilization.

Substrate and Repotting Requires a light, airy, and well-draining substrate – a mixture of peat or coco coir with perlite (1:1). Repot in spring, always into a pot only one size larger. It will appreciate support for its upright stems.

Warning Begonia maculata is toxic to pets and children. Keep out of their reach.
